Economic Policy Analyst, Tax (Quantitative Economics and Statistics – QUEST) (Senior) (Multiple Positions) (1688958), Ernst & Young U.S. LLP, Washington, DC. Participate in engagement teams and activities to provide quantitative advisory services for clients, including tax policy analysis; economic and fiscal impact modeling, based on applied economics and statistics. Conduct modeling to estimate the economic impact of industries, companies, and new facilities. Provide support in developing and analyzing tax and other policy proposals, legislation, and public programs and estimating their economic and revenue effects. Provide forecasting of macroeconomic metrics. Write accessible reports of study findings. Provide technical guidance and share knowledge with team members with diverse skills and backgrounds. Consistently deliver quality client services focusing on more complex, judgmental and/or specialized issues. Demonstrate technical capabilities and professional knowledge. Learn about EY and its service lines and actively assess and present ways to apply knowledge and services. Full time employment, Monday – Friday, 40 hours per week, 8:30 am – 5:30 pm.
